ABOUT THE NORDEX GROUP:


The manufacture of wind energy plants in the on-shore segment has been our core competence and passion for around 35 years.

With more than 43 GW installed capacity worldwide, our turbines supply sustainable energy to more than 80% of the global energy market and we are one of the largest companies in the wind industry.

National subsidiaries in more than 30 markets and production facilities in Germany, Spain, Brazil, the USA, Mexico and India offer our more than 9,000 employees the opportunity for international and intercultural cooperation.
